Wood Steps Replacement Questions
What types of wood steps can be replaced? Replacement services cover various wood steps, including porch stairs, deck steps, and interior staircase treads.
How do I know if my wood steps need replacement? Signs include rotting, cracking, looseness, or significant wear that affects safety and stability.
Are there different wood options for replacements? Yes, common choices include pressure-treated lumber, cedar, and redwood, depending on the project needs.
What should property owners consider before replacing wood steps? Consider the existing structure, desired appearance, and durability requirements for the replacement steps.
